The Smart Way to Hire a Realtor in St. Charles, Illinois
Hiring the appropriate realtor can make the distinction between a smooth home transaction and months of stress. In a competitive suburban market like St. Charles, Illinois, buyers and sellers want more than just someone with a real estate license. They want a knowledgeable local professional, a powerful negotiator, and a professional who understands easy methods to position a property for success.
St. Charles is known for its charming downtown, Fox River views, excellent schools, and a mixture of historic homes and modern developments. Because the market includes such a wide range of property styles and price points, working with a realtor who really understands neighborhood variations is essential. A home close to the river, for example, requires a different pricing and marketing strategy than a newer property in a deliberate subdivision.
The first smart step is to look for hyper local experience. A realtor who regularly works in St. Charles will know current sale costs, buyer demand trends, and which areas are growing in popularity. This insight helps sellers worth homes accurately and permits buyers to make competitive provides without overpaying. Ask potential agents how many homes they have purchased or sold in St. Charles specifically, not just in the broader Chicagoland area.
Strong communication is one other key factor. Real estate transactions move quickly, and delays can cost you opportunities or money. A reliable realtor responds promptly, keeps you up to date at every stage, and explains every step clearly. Throughout your first conversation, pay attention to how well they listen to your goals. Whether or not you might be looking for a quiet neighborhood, top rated schools, or a walkable location near downtown, your agent should tailor their approach to your priorities.
Marketing strategy is especially vital if you are selling. A smart realtor makes use of professional photography, compelling property descriptions, and targeted on-line publicity to draw severe buyers. Simply listing a home on the MLS isn't any longer enough. Ask how the agent promotes listings on-line, on social media, and through local networks. The suitable strategy can increase showing activity and lead to stronger offers.
For buyers, negotiation skills can have a direct impact in your backside line. In competitive worth ranges, a number of affords are common. An skilled St. Charles realtor knows the right way to structure an offer that stands out while still protecting your interests. This could embody advising on inspection terms, closing timelines, or contingencies that make your offer more interesting to the seller.
Credentials and reviews also matter. Look for agents with positive shopper testimonials that mention responsiveness, professionalism, and results. Online reviews often reveal how an agent handles challenges, not just smooth transactions. You may also ask for references from recent purchasers in St. Charles to get firsthand perception into their experience.
Availability shouldn't be overlooked. Some high producing agents juggle too many clients at once, which can limit personal attention. Ask what number of active clients they at the moment have and who will handle daily communication. You want to really feel assured that your questions will not be pushed aside throughout critical moments.
Finally, trust your instincts. Buying or selling a home is a major monetary decision, and also you will be working closely with your realtor for weeks or months. Choose someone who is trustworthy, patient, and genuinely invested in your success. While you mix local experience, strong communication, proven marketing, and strong negotiation skills, you position your self for a smoother and more profitable real estate experience in St. Charles, Illinois.
